如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

探索Native.js蓝牙:开启物联网新时代

探索Native.js蓝牙:开启物联网新时代

在当今的物联网(IoT)时代,Native.js蓝牙技术正成为连接物理世界与数字世界的桥梁。Native.js作为一个轻量级的JavaScript运行时环境,结合蓝牙技术,可以实现设备间的无缝通信和数据交换。本文将为大家详细介绍Native.js蓝牙的基本概念、应用场景以及其在物联网中的重要性。

什么是Native.js蓝牙?

Native.js是一个基于JavaScript的运行时环境,旨在提供高效、轻量级的解决方案,使开发者能够在资源受限的设备上运行JavaScript代码。蓝牙作为一种短距离无线通信技术,广泛应用于各种设备的互联互通。将Native.js蓝牙结合,可以在设备上实现复杂的逻辑控制和数据处理,同时保持低功耗和高效能。

Native.js蓝牙的优势

  1. 跨平台兼容性:Native.js支持多种操作系统,包括但不限于Linux、Windows、macOS等,这意味着开发者可以编写一次代码,运行在多种设备上。

  2. 低功耗:蓝牙技术本身就以低功耗著称,结合Native.js的优化,可以在保持设备长时间运行的同时,减少电池消耗。

  3. 易于开发:JavaScript作为一种广泛使用的编程语言,开发者可以利用现有的JavaScript生态系统,快速开发和调试蓝牙应用。

  4. 安全性:Native.js提供了安全的沙箱环境,确保代码在执行时不会对设备造成损害,同时蓝牙协议也提供了多种安全机制。

应用场景

  1. 智能家居:通过Native.js蓝牙,可以轻松实现智能家居设备的互联互通。例如,智能灯泡、智能门锁、温度控制器等设备可以通过蓝牙连接到一个中央控制系统,实现自动化控制。

  2. 健康监测:可穿戴设备如智能手表、心率监测器等,可以通过蓝牙将数据传输到手机或其他设备上,利用Native.js进行数据分析和用户反馈。

  3. 工业自动化:在工业环境中,Native.js蓝牙可以用于机器之间的通信,实现生产线的自动化控制和监测,提高生产效率。

  4. 游戏和娱乐:蓝牙手柄、VR设备等可以通过Native.js实现与游戏主机或电脑的无缝连接,提供更好的用户体验。

  5. 物流和仓储:在物流和仓储管理中,蓝牙标签和扫描器可以与Native.js结合,实现实时库存管理和资产追踪。

未来展望

随着物联网的进一步发展,Native.js蓝牙技术将在更多领域得到应用。未来,我们可以期待看到更多创新性的应用,如智能城市、无人驾驶汽车等领域的应用。同时,随着技术的进步,Native.js和蓝牙的结合将变得更加高效、安全和易于使用。

总结

Native.js蓝牙技术为开发者提供了一个强大的工具,使得物联网设备的开发变得更加简单和高效。通过本文的介绍,希望大家对Native.js蓝牙有了一个全面的了解,并能在实际项目中灵活运用这一技术,推动物联网的发展。无论是智能家居、健康监测还是工业自动化,Native.js蓝牙都展现了其巨大的潜力和广阔的应用前景。